Description

The Golden Trumpet is a vigorous, evergreen vine native to tropical regions of South America. Its glossy, dark green leaves provide a lush backdrop for its showy, trumpet-shaped flowers. These flowers are a bright, sunny yellow and can reach up to 5 inches in length. They bloom prolifically throughout the warmer months, attracting pollinators like butterflies and hummingbirds. This plant is often grown as a climber or trained to grow as a shrub.

Plant Care:

  • Light: The Golden Trumpet thrives in full sun. It needs at least 6 hours of direct sunlight daily to bloom profusely. 
  • Water: Water your Allamanda regularly, keeping the soil consistently moist but not soggy. During hot, dry periods, you may need to water more frequently.
  • Soil: Plant your Allamanda in well-draining soil that is rich in organic matter. Ensure good drainage to prevent root rot.
  • Temperature: The Golden Trumpet prefers warm temperatures. It can tolerate mild frosts, but prolonged cold temperatures can damage the plant.
  • Fertilizer: Fertilize your plant regularly during the growing season with a balanced liquid fertilizer. 
  • Pruning: Prune your Allamanda regularly to maintain its shape and encourage new growth. You can also prune to remove dead or damaged branches.
  • Toxicity: Please note that all parts of the Allamanda plant are toxic if ingested. Keep it away from children and pets.

Remember, the Golden Trumpet is a tropical plant, so it may not be suitable for regions with harsh winters.
If you live in a colder climate, you can grow it in a container and bring it indoors during the winter months.
